Bosnia and Herzegovina – Mandate of the EU Special Representative


COUNCIL OF THE EUROPEAN UNION


 


Brussels, 26 July 2006


12020/06 (Presse 229)


 


The Council adopted, by written procedure, a joint action amending the mandate of the EU Special Representative (EUSR) in Bosnia and Herzegovina (11450/06).


The mandate of the EUSR in BiH, Christian Schwarz-Schilling, has been modified to include, as a policy objective, support to planning for a reinforced EUSR office in the context of the closure of the Office of the High Representative, foreseen on 30 June 2007.


The financial reference amount intended to cover the expenditure related to the mandate of the EUSR is EUR 1 million.


The Council appointed Christian Schwarz-Schilling, who is also High Representative in Bosnia and Herzegovina, as the EUSR in BiH on 30 January 2006.
